Job Description

The Dispatcher receives assistance requests from clients and customers, and assigns individuals and teams to respond to those requests.
PAY RATE
$22.28- $24.28 The pay listed is the hourly range or the hourly rate for this position. A specific offer will vary based on applicant's experience, skills, abilities, geographic location, and alignment with market data.

  • Establish and maintain effective communication and working relationships with co-workers, shift coordinators, supervisors, managers, etc.
  • Schedule and dispatch resources, which may be team members, crews, and teams to appropriate locations according to customer requests, specifications, or needs, using telephones and email.
  • Ensure timely and efficient movement of team members according to work orders and/or resource schedules.
  • Oversee all communications within specifically assigned area(s).
  • Record and maintain files and records of dispatch information including temporary employee time and schedules.
  • Confer with ABM supervisors and team members to address questions, problems, and requests for temporary coverage.
  • Compile statistics and reports on work progress.
